What are the responsibilities and job description for the Pharmacy Technician II position at MI_MHP Mercy Health Partners?
Employment Type: Full time Shift: Rotating Shift Description: SUMMARY Under the direction of a Registered Pharmacist, assists Pharmacists in preparing and distributing medications, maintaining the drug inventory, and maintaining patient records. Provides courteous, cooperative, and timely service to patients, visitors and staff. Qualification Education Minimum High school education or equivalent. Preferred Completion of formal pharmacy technician training program. Credentials/Licensure Minimum Licensed as a Pharmacy Technician in the State of Michigan. Minimum Certified Pharmacy Technician (CPhT) by the Pharmacy Technician Certification Board (PTCB). Related Experience Minimum One year of pharmacy work experience. Other Knowledge, Skills and Abilities Minimum Good written and verbal communication skills. Good math skills (multiplication, division, addition, subtraction) in calculations involving fractions, decimals, percentages and volumes. Good communication skills. Computer Competency Familiarity with standard desktop and windows-based computer system, including email, e-learning, intranet and computer navigation. Ability to use other software required to perform essential functions. Physical/Mental Minimum Repetitive use of hands and fingers (e.g., preparing IV admixtures, use of a computer keyboard). May require lifting and carrying light loads (up to 40 lbs.), including boxes, equipment, unit dose-cassettes, and IV solutions and stooping or kneeling (e.g., to pick up items from the floor, to remove and replace items on lower shelves, and to file documents in lower file drawers). Sitting, walking, or standing for long periods of time (4-8 hours) is often necessary. Must be able to physically operate the equipment for the job. WORKING CONDITIONS Potential for exposure to infectious patients and materials. Potential for exposure to hazardous and toxic substances (including chemotherapy, cytotoxic drugs, and cleaning solutions). Potential for sticks or cuts by needles and other sharp items. Potential for musculoskeletal injuries if proper lifting and carrying techniques are not used. 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S Prepares, packages, and distributes medication orders per physician/pharmacist request, or prearranged work assignment according to established policies, procedures and protocols. Maintains adequate stock of medications and supplies according to established policies and procedures. Contributes to effective and quality operation of the department. Maintains logs, records, and other required documentation; files documentation; answers telephone and pneumatic tube; and handles cash transactions. Prepares IV admixtures and other sterile products. Processes medication charges and credits according to established policy. Basic pharmacy computer order entry. Participate in the training, education, precepting, and evaluation of pharmacy students and/or residents as assigned. Performs other related duties as assigned.
